The road in is dirt for about 11 miles. It was ok in most parts, although there is quite a few spots with heavy washboarding. Also, watch out for the herd of sheep that cross the road...they do NOT move when you beep the horn...we decided to take a break on the road until they decided to give way.

There was a nice amount of space between each site. There were some tent campers, a couple of van conversions and quite a few RV and TT's. There were no pull through sites, but there was enough room to turn around and back in.

The fish had been stocked with trout earlier in the week. My grandkids loved fishing there.

It was nice and quiet after hours...but because this is a family oriented campground, there was lots of activity and noise during the day.

I recommend this campground and will continue to stay here, we enjoy it. There are, however, pros and cons.
Pros- Dog friendly. The hosts are very helpful, enforce the park rules and friendly. There are enough trails to hike ( we recommend the hike around the lake). The park is isolated but close enough to Williams (a 20-25 minute one way trip) . Great star gazing spots. Lake is great for kayaks with private rental group. A snack bar. If you time it right, the dirt road is graded and smooth, as opposed to choppy. As is the usual, weekday crowd and traffic is good.

Cons- Rules must be enforced on weekends, including music and off road vehicles. Park can be a drive if you need an item ( 20-25 minute round trip) in a pinch. Bathrooms are cleaned frequently but can still have that smell- be mindful where they are when reserving your spot. Weekend crowds and traffic can be much. INTERMITTENT CELL USE.

First and foremost…the road in will adversely affect your RV. I would not come here again just because I choose not to destroy my equipment with mikes of washboarded roads and fine dust that will get everywhere. If this had a better road to it, it would be a great little campground. However, this issue has been stated by others, and I’m here to reiterate it. Tent campers should enjoy, and the small lake was lovely.

Also, no water on, which wasn’t communicated via Recreation.gov, but luckily I found this to be the case prior to going so brought plenty. The dump station is closed as there is a host parked there. This is a big negative as far as I’m concerned.

Noise from OHV traffic parading through the campground and constantly barking dogs in other sites were other annoying things that kept us from enjoying a beautiful and what should have been peaceful location.

The camp host admonished us about parking a vehicle off the edge of the paved site driveway on smashed down dead pine needles, yet did absolutely nothing about constantly barking dogs and generators that were run during quiet hours or even ALL NIGHT at a nearby site. Very disappointed in many aspects here about posting rules but not upholding them, and the Kaibab National Forest should be providing better service to its patrons if they are going to charge full rates.

The positives, including the gorgeous setting, were the hiking at nearby Sycamore Canyon gorge, the great little snack shack at the lake day use area, watching the fishing osprey at the lake, and the fairly clean and well-stocked pit/vault toilets.

All in all though, I would pick many other campgrounds in neighboring National Forests before I would consider returning here. 2 of 5 stars and honestly considered lower but then considered some of the good things about the location.

Verizon service was hit and miss bouncing from 1 to 2 bars but I was able to use the internet some.

There are several ways to reach the campground but all are Forest Service dirt washboard roads. Even at slow speeds the kitchen sink in our RV bounced loose!

Once you survive, the drive was worthwhile. Very nicely laid out camp sites, with some having concrete or gravel pads, and lake views. Numerous vault toilet restrooms that are clean, well stocked, and scent free. There is a snack shack that serves burgers, hot dogs and sweet treats. Kayak rentals are also available at the snack shack. It is a large but popular campground and fishing lake, but in early spring there were very few campers. Would definitely return to camp here again.
